What Is an Alcohol Rehab Center?

An alcohol rehab center is a treatment facility that uses assistance, care, and therapy to individuals with alcohol use disorder, or AUD. Treatment is essential for numerous factors. It can supply education about AUD, help individuals safely stop drinking, deal with the underlying reasons for addiction, and assist people find out much healthier coping, tension management, and relapse prevention abilities so they can stay sober.

Treatment is provided in a variety of settings and at various levels of care, which can differ depending on your distinct healing requirements and issues. According to the National Institute on Substance Abuse (NIDA), reliable treatment needs to be customized to your private health and recovery requirements and consider your mental health, social health, and any task or legal issues.

People’s requirements can change throughout the course of treatment, and they may go up and down in intensity and to different levels of care at alcohol treatment centers.

Inpatient alcohol rehab implies that you live onsite at a treatment facility for the length of treatment. This can include medical facilities, clinics, or other domestic alcohol rehab facilities that use 24-hour care.

This setting can be valuable for a vast array of individuals, including those with severe AUD, severe co-occurring disorders, those with a history of relapse, individuals with unstable living situations or restricted transportation, and teenagers.

Kinds Of Inpatient Rehab

Common inpatient treatment settings consist of:

  • Long-lasting residential rehab. This provides a steady living circumstance, a structured environment without diversion and sets off (individuals, places, and things that make you wish to consume), and encouraging look after a longer amount of time. It can be low or high intensity. It’s appropriate for individuals without stable houses or helpful households, or those with severe addictions or co-occurring disorders.
  • Short-term residential treatment. This usually happens in a health center, medical center, or other facility that uses 24/7 medical oversight. These centers usually offer alcohol detox services to help manage alcohol withdrawal symptoms, as well as rehab treatment.
  • Sober living homes. These are likewise called recovery housing, transitional real estate, or midway houses. They use short-term transitional housing and different forms of support to individuals who have actually just recently finished a rehab program and are transitioning back to their day-to-day lives.

Outpatient Alcohol Rehab

Outpatient alcohol rehab provides treatment services at a health center, community mental university hospital, freestanding substance use rehab center, or health center. You live in your home and travel to the facility for treatment services on a routine schedule. Some outpatient programs offer some or all of its shows via remote or virtual rehab delivered by means of telehealth.

Individuals who may take advantage of outpatient treatment centers for alcohol include those who are stepping down from inpatient treatment or individuals with less severe addictions, good health, strong social supports, trusted transportation, and steady living environments. Outpatient rehab can occur at different levels of intensity.

Types of Outpatient Rehab

  • Common types of outpatient alcohol rehab centers consist of:
  • Requirement outpatient, where you have regular office sees for counseling and treatment medicines, if necessary. Standard outpatient programs typically require going to treatment 1 to 3 times per week, though some satisfy every day.
  • Extensive outpatient, or IOP. This is a greater level of intensity that provides between 9 and 20 hours of structured programs weekly.
  • Partial hospitalization, or PHP. This is the most intense level of outpatient care. It includes participating in treatment every day for at least 6 hours per day.

Alcohol Treatment Medicines

Medications may be utilized in an alcohol treatment program to help individuals stop drinking and avoid relapse. Some common medications consist of:

  • Disulfiram. This medicine can assist people avoid alcohol use while in recovery because it triggers undesirable symptoms if you consume.
  • Acamprosate. This assists individuals preserve abstinence and avoid relapse. It helps in reducing undesirable symptoms that might sometimes accompany ongoing abstinence, such as sleeping disorders (problem sleeping) and anxiety.
  • Naltrexone. This can assist individuals remain sober since it minimizes cravings and blocks the enjoyable and satisfying effects of alcohol if they do consume.

The duration of alcohol rehab can differ by setting and your individual needs. Common treatment lengths for inpatient rehab are 28 to 30 days, 60 days, or 90 days. It can likewise be longer in the case of a long-lasting residential alcohol rehab center, which can last approximately a year. Outpatient rehab normally lasts 2 months to a year.

In a lot of cases, treatment doesn’t follow a basic timeline or set endpoint. Given that addiction is a persistent, relapsing disease, lots of people find it valuable to go to support groups, therapy sessions, or other continuing care after formal rehab has actually ended.

Does California Insurance Cover Alcohol Rehab?

drug and alcohol rehab in Mojave California

This can depend on your strategy, but, in general, a lot of plans do cover some kind of addiction treatment. The Mental Health Parity and Addiction Equity Act (MHPAEA) of 2008 states that insurance strategies should provide the very same level of advantages for mental health and substance use treatment and services that they provide for medical and surgical care.

Different factors may affect your coverage, such as the level of healthcare and the setting for the program you picked, along with location, program length, features, your specific plan, and other considerations. Can I Get Alcohol Rehab in Mojave without Insurance?

Expense should not stop you from looking for help. There are other payment choices if you do not have insurance or your insurance does not cover rehab, such as:

  • Utilizing payment plans, moving scales, or scholarships. Some rehabs offer various forms of financial support based on your financial requirement or capability to pay.
  • Going to a facility with public financing. You may have the ability to find complimentary or low-cost rehab options; it is necessary to be mindful that states have funds set aside to assist people without insurance.
  • Requesting Medicare or Medicaid. Medicare is a federal health insurance program for individuals aged 65 and older or specific younger individuals who fulfill eligibility requirements. Medicaid is the government-funded health insurance plan for individuals with low earnings who satisfy eligibility requirements.
  • Paying out-of-pocket. For instance, you may use cost savings or ask family or buddies for assistance.
  • Taking out loans. You might get loans to cover some or all of the cost of treatment.
  • Alcoholic Anonymous or comparable shared help groups. Recent proof recommends AA and other complimentary mutual aid groups based on 12-step assistance can be as effective as other well‐established treatments for achieving abstaining and other alcohol‐related outcomes such as drinking consequences, drinking strength, and addiction severity.
